Rumour has it that Intel is planning to release their new Coffee Lake series of CPUs alongside their new Z370 motherboard platform in Q4 2017, which takes place between the start of October and the end of December. 

Previously, it was suggested that Coffee Lake was moved up for a summer 2017 release but this new rumour suggests that Coffee Lake may arrive later than expected, but still within a year of the launch of Kaby Lake.     

Intel’s Z370 platform is expected to come with significant networking updates, with both wired and wireless upgrades. This could mean that Z370 motherboards will have integrated WIFI or perhaps use enhanced versions of the Ethernet standard (2.5Gb, 5GB or 10GB?).

Intel’s Coffee Lake CPUs are expected to launch with up to 6 CPU cores, which will be the highest core count that Intel has ever offered on a mainstream CPU socket. At this time the clock speeds and other improvements that will be included with Coffee Lake are unknown.
